“ My lord, is there anything there that doesn’t try to kill you?”
From Terry Pratchett ’s The Last Continent.
‘ Almost all animals and plants in XXXX are dangerous; when Death requested a book about the dangerous creatures of XXXX from his library, he was subsequently hit by a large pile of books consisting of the various volumes of “ Dangerous Mammals, Reptiles, Amphibians, Birds, Fish, Jellyfish, Insects, Spiders, Crustaceans, Grasses, Trees, Mosses and Lichens of Terror Incognita ”, the total books going up to Volume 29C Part 3, while a request for information about the harmless creatures merely produced a note saying “Some of the sheep”. The land is inhospitable because the flora and fauna all hate you and there is never any rain.’
I always thought ‘some of the sheep’ summed up Australia's safe animal population quite nicely.
